Ideagen EHS spring release: Version 24.1
Join us for an exclusive session tailored just for you, our valued customers, where the Ideagen EHS team will highlight many of the exciting new features and enhancements arriving this spring in our version 24.1 release of Ideagen EHS. We are proud to present this update as a testament to our commitment to your operational excellence.
Key takeaways:
- Explore enhancements that make managing translations easier and more intuitive for administrators than ever before.
- Discover the convenience and efficiency of QR codes for reporting incidents of all types, streamlining and easing your reporting processes.
- Explore the added confidentiality features for risk assessments, ensuring sensitive data remains protected.
- Experience improved flexibility in audits and inspections with cascading and text response question types, tailored to your specific needs.
- Simplify the assignment of training with the ability to bulk assign trainings to all or select employees across multiple locations, saving time and effort.
